Transaction 63094910b3ded3c9b3c8fb43d3f20e7ca256655a2d3e39d6e105f639296104b6
1 Input
1 Output
-
63094910b3ded3c9b3c8fb43d3f20e7ca256655a2d3e39d6e105f639296104b6:0
- value
- 85986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5f5443b0c58044842fe6737c31597bc377099e5 OP_EQUAL
- address
- 3Q7XHxay3KQcSDUqqrQQ89iqa8c5DKeoZu